Minimesters and Financial Aid

Summary

How minimesters affect the disbursement of financial aid funds

Disbursement Timing

We can't disburse any financial aid funds for a class until you have been reported as actively attending. If you're taking a four- or eight-week minimester class, the class will not count toward your registered hours until after the "census date" (or 10 percent point) of the class. Therefore, you won't get any refund money associated with that class until after the class begins meeting.
